QdrantMemoryBuilderExtensions.WithQdrantMemoryStore Method
Definition
Important
Some information relates to prerelease product that may be substantially modified before it’s released. Microsoft makes no warranties, express or implied, with respect to the information provided here.
Overloads
WithQdrantMemoryStore(MemoryBuilder, String, Int32) |
Registers Qdrant memory connector. |
WithQdrantMemoryStore(MemoryBuilder, HttpClient, Int32, String) |
Registers Qdrant memory connector. |
WithQdrantMemoryStore(MemoryBuilder, String, Int32)
Registers Qdrant memory connector.
public static Microsoft.SemanticKernel.Memory.MemoryBuilder WithQdrantMemoryStore (this Microsoft.SemanticKernel.Memory.MemoryBuilder builder, string endpoint, int vectorSize);
static member WithQdrantMemoryStore : Microsoft.SemanticKernel.Memory.MemoryBuilder * string * int -> Microsoft.SemanticKernel.Memory.MemoryBuilder
<Extension()>
Public Function WithQdrantMemoryStore (builder As MemoryBuilder, endpoint As String, vectorSize As Integer) As MemoryBuilder
Parameters
- builder
- MemoryBuilder
The MemoryBuilder instance.
- endpoint
- String
The Qdrant Vector Database endpoint.
- vectorSize
- Int32
The size of the vectors.
Returns
Updated Memory builder including Qdrant memory connector.
Applies to
WithQdrantMemoryStore(MemoryBuilder, HttpClient, Int32, String)
Registers Qdrant memory connector.
public static Microsoft.SemanticKernel.Memory.MemoryBuilder WithQdrantMemoryStore (this Microsoft.SemanticKernel.Memory.MemoryBuilder builder, System.Net.Http.HttpClient httpClient, int vectorSize, string? endpoint = default);
static member WithQdrantMemoryStore : Microsoft.SemanticKernel.Memory.MemoryBuilder * System.Net.Http.HttpClient * int * string -> Microsoft.SemanticKernel.Memory.MemoryBuilder
<Extension()>
Public Function WithQdrantMemoryStore (builder As MemoryBuilder, httpClient As HttpClient, vectorSize As Integer, Optional endpoint As String = Nothing) As MemoryBuilder
Parameters
- builder
- MemoryBuilder
The MemoryBuilder instance.
- httpClient
- HttpClient
The optional HttpClient instance used for making HTTP requests.
- vectorSize
- Int32
The size of the vectors.
- endpoint
- String
The Qdrant Vector Database endpoint. If not specified, the base address of the HTTP client is used.
Returns
Updated Memory builder including Qdrant memory connector.